Join us for a Soul-filled night at the Colvin House, as Nikki O’Neill and her band celebrate the release of her new album, Stories I Only Tell My Friends (Blackbird Record Label) with a special show!
Deeply in love with classic soul, rhythm & blues and gospel from an early age, music journalists have called Nikki O’Neill “an expressive, nuanced singer and excellent guitarist” who makes albums with songs that demonstrate “a remarkable sense of melody.”
Stories I Only Tell My Friends is supported by the Illinois Arts Council, who chose O’Neill as one of their Creative Catalyst Grant recipients for 2025. You can get your vinyl or CD copy at the show, and have it signed by the band.
